Selenium provides mechanisms for interacting with web pages through browsers, including locating and interacting with specific features within a web interface. A tool such as Selenium IDE or Katalon can be used to perform the testing in a relatively manual fashion

This “skills-centric” course is about 50% hands-on lab and 50% lecture designed to train attendees in the most current, effective techniques with the soundest industry practices. Working in a hands-on learning environment, guided by our expert team. In this course you will learn about:
· Understand web page testing needs and how Selenium meets those needs
· Analyze a web application from a functional and testing perspective
· Design, code, and run manual tests using the Katalon Recorder
· Use Selenium constructs to locate elements on a web page
· Test web page forms and the elements in those forms
· Use test suites to organize and manage tests
· Review Java constructs needed to by testers in working with WebDriver
· Design code and run automated Selenium tests using the Java WebDriver API
· Use the WebDriver API to test advanced web features such as delayed responses and Ajax
· Using a combination of JUnit 5 features and WebDriver to consume streams of data for testing
· Focus on Best Practices for Selenium testing using the Java WebDriver API
